Raspberry Pi NoIR camera low framerate

Hope this is in the right place. I am trying to use a raspberry pi NoIR camera (with a RPi zero running in peripheral mode) as a USB webcam (as described here). The webcam runs fine and at 30fps if i just run it through windows, or if I use Python to acquire frames.

 

Running it in Labview (2020), it runs at only about 2fps. If i look into MAX I can see that there is only one option under "video mode" and that is for the camera running at 2fps (1920x1080 MJPG 2.00fps). Other USB webcams I have all have multiple options and can run at higher framerates.

 

Why would the camera run fine in windows camera view but not in Labview? I imagine it is some driver issue, but I don't know how to see what drivers the camera is using in labview. Any advice appreciated!

Those instructions for configuring the emulated camera set the 2hz rate:

 

cat <<EOF > /sys/kernel/config/usb_gadget/pi4/functions/uvc.usb0/streaming/mjpeg/m/1080p/dwFrameInterval
5000000
EOF
